Solved HP1200 Wont Install on 2003 "severe error encountered" Posted on 2005-02-11 Windows Server 2003 1 Verified http://h20564.www2.hp.com/hpsc/doc/public/display?docId=c01672872 Solution 23 Comments 1,404 Views Last Modified: 2008-01-09 I'm trying to install a new HP1200dtn in my Win 2003 server. This printer and install process worked fine on another machine running windows wp, and the printer functions, so I know the printer itself is working on this network. On the Windows 2003 server... I have tried the standard install disk which results afert https://www.experts-exchange.com/questions/21311167/HP1200-Wont-Install-on-2003-severe-error-encountered.html almost completing the install process, in "Business Inkjet setup process has encountered a severe error and will now exit. Reboot and run setup again". I also tried simply adding the printer via add printer, this process gets almost done (click finish) and then error message "Printer not Installed. Operation could not be completed" occurs. I spent an hour on the help line with HP, we tried a number of things, non worked, we downloaded new drivers from Microsoft, those did same thing. We stoped, cleared and restarted the print spool, that did not help. We downloaded the current 2003 drivers from HP site and tried it, same result. We also tried setting the initial printe port to "print to file" with hope of connecting the machine after drivers installed, same result there. NOTE>>>> Server is running terminal server, and remotely connected printers do also work fine. AND I did try to simply add the driver via terminal server manager add printer and add printer driver, neither worked, same result. WINDOWS XP Home Edition, with 3 printers, one of the printers are HP LaserJet 2300d (series PCL 6) which I installed about 2 years ago and it worked http://www.pcreview.co.uk/threads/can-not-install-hp-printer.3064515/ fine. But, about 3 weeks ago it start to make problems when the print https://answers.yahoo.com/question/index?qid=20120415235255AA57fmg dialog box was opened and I clicked on properties the program closed, a sheet that was configured to be printed on both sides printed on 2 separate sheets, and the end of the page came out first from the primter instead of coming out on the top side first. After it did so several times I uninstalled the hp laserjet printer and I tried to reinstall it again several ways for more then 25 times and it does not install. I downloaded the newest printer driver from HP for the printer and it did not installed itself on the computer. The messages that it gave me was, an error occurred during the installation of the device The parameter is incorrect, a 2nd message was - unable to install printer Either the printer name hp laserjet has was typed incorrectly or the specified printer has lost its connection to the server, a 3rd message the HP LaserJet 2300 setup program has encountered a severe error, and more. I think that the problem start since the microsoft update 925902 which was in the beginning of April 32007, I installed the recommended update KB935843 and the problem is not solved.
